How to fill out the Fraternity & Sorority Disaffiliation Form - Chapter (Blue Card) online
The Fraternity & Sorority Disaffiliation Form - Chapter (Blue Card) is an essential document for members choosing to terminate their affiliation with a chapter. This guide provides a straightforward, step-by-step approach to help users accurately complete the form online.
Follow the steps to fill out the disaffiliation form online
- Press the ‘Get Form’ button to access the form and open it in your preferred online editor.
- Begin by reading the disaffiliation agreement section thoroughly. This section clarifies the requirements for disaffiliation and reinstatement.
- Select the appropriate checkbox to indicate your agreement with the disaffiliation terms. You must choose only one option.
- Enter the name of the member who is being removed from the chapter's roster in the designated field.
- Input the NETID of the member who is being disaffiliated.
- Select the organization name from the options provided.
- Choose one reason for disaffiliation from the list. Ensure that you select a valid option.
- If 'Other' is selected as the reason, provide a brief explanation in the space provided.
- Read the disaffiliation form completion statement and select the corresponding checkbox to acknowledge your understanding.
- Input the name of the chapter president in the specified field.
- Choose the option that indicates the chapter president's agreement to the terms, selecting one choice only.
- Enter the chapter president's email address in the required format (name@myschool.edu).
- Review all provided information for accuracy before finalizing the form.
- Upon completion, save your changes, and you may have options to download, print, or share the form as needed.
